Anyway, the Australian Nationwide Antarctic Analysis Expedition wanted a small, low-cost car with extra all-terrain functionality, as their Beetles have been restricted to driving only a few miles round base camp.

Enter Teddy O’Hare, who was each an engineer and ran the enterprise that introduced Canadian heavy responsibility vehicles all the best way to the Australian researchers within the Antarctic. O’Hare deserves a publish all his personal, as he was a completely unbelievable man. His workshop was answerable for constructing the primary jet-powered truck, which turned the primary truck to interrupt 200 mph. It was from his workshop the Mini-Trac was born.

O’Hare knew from his import enterprise that almost all tracked automobiles have been front-wheel drive, in order that’s what he went on the lookout for. Add the Expedition’s necessities of low-cost and small and actually just one car on the time match the invoice—the Mini, or Morris Minor Mini because it was identified again then. After testing and some modifications—actually, lower than you would possibly assume—the Mini-Trac made its debut ice-side in 1965.

It took numerous experimentation and, in the long run, the Mini-Trac fell to that deadly flaw of most tiny British vehicles of the period; reliability.
